**Ticket: Encoding mis-detection on uploaded text files**

Uploads to Scrivport containing Windows-1252 smart quotes are being detected as UTF-8, producing replacement characters in previews. Please extend the sniffer to fall back on byte-frequency heuristics when UTF-8 validation fails, and add fixtures for mixed-encoding files. Reproduce using the sample set attached to the build below.

pipeline stamp: htk3_69f

// Undo/redo in Sketchmere uses a bounded command stack shared across
// plugins. Plugin-issued commands are coalesced if they arrive within the
// merge window and target the same node; otherwise each push consumes one
// stack slot. Exceeding the stack depth silently drops the oldest entry —
// do not rely on unbounded history. Batch your mutations where possible.
// The constants governing stack depth and merge behavior follow below.

tuning constants:
QUOTAS = {
    "druwyn": 5,
    "holix": 5,
    "zorath": 5,
    "holwyn": 10,
}

Ticket #2087 — hot-reload watcher in wrong env

Heads up for whoever reviews the ConfigMint PR: the hot-reload watcher in the Dapplewick cluster was pointed at the sample env file, so config changes reloaded instantly in dev but silently never in prod. Classic. The fix moves the watch path to the real env file and adds a checksum guard. One catch — the reload endpoint now requires auth, so the env file needs this line added at the bottom:

env line for fajog-hafog: COURIER_KEY8=fab12c72

### Key Ceremony Checklist — Item 7: PickPath Optimizer Escrow

Confirm that the escrow bundle for the PickPath warehouse pick-list optimizer (operated by Draymill Logistics) has been sealed in the presence of two witnesses. Verify the tamper-evident bag number against the ceremony ledger, and confirm both witnesses initialed the custody sheet. Before sealing, the ceremony lead must read aloud and verify the recovery passphrase that unseals the optimizer's signing key, exactly as recorded below.

vault phrase of kawef-yahop = wenir-jorox-druys-belion-kelion-lamvan-frawyn-norael-julox-raleth-rusax-oliys-holael